Flowace Whitelisting Requirements

Whitelist Flowace Services


in Antivirus, Firewall, VPN, and Proxy Software


Antivirus, firewall, VPN, and proxy software can interfere with essential Flowace services, leading to tracking failures, missed screenshots, or inaccurate reporting. Whitelisting the hosts, paths, and executables listed below ensures Flowace runs without interruption.


This article is intended primarily for IT administrators configuring company infrastructure. Individuals running Flowace on a personal device should follow the relevant operating system section below.



1. Hosts to Whitelist


Allow the following hosts on the firewall, web proxy, DNS / content filter, and SSL inspection engine. All traffic is outbound HTTPS on port 443/TCP.

Host / EndPoint

Purpose

api.flowace.in

Primary API endpoint. Authentication, activity sync, and agent configuration.

screenshots.flowace.in

Screenshot upload and retrieval.

(tenant).flowace.in

Client tenant URL. Web dashboard, reporting, and administrator access.

production-flowace-reports .s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com

Report generation and download.

flowace-resources .s3-ap-southeast-1.amazonaws.com

On-page artifacts. Images and icons served in the dashboard.

de9j6rhbdgsa2.cloudfront.net

CDN for on-page artifacts (images and icons).

s3-ap-southeast-1.amazonaws.com /updates.windows.squirrel/ /updates.windows.squirrel.stealth.generic/

Windows agent builds and updates (Squirrel updater), including the stealth generic build.


Whitelist by host name, not by IP address.

Flowace endpoints are cloud-hosted and the underlying IPs change without notice. Add all hosts above to the SSL/TLS decryption bypass list. The two update paths share a single host: if the proxy cannot match on path, allow s3-ap-southeast-1.amazonaws.com in full.


2. Windows Agent


2.1 Installation Path


All Flowace Windows services install to a single path. Where folder-level exclusions are supported, this one entry covers every executable listed in Section 2.2.


*%LocalAppData%\Flowace*
*Resolves to: C:\Users\AppData\Local\Flowace*


2.2 Services / Executables


Add each of the following executables to antivirus, EDR, and application-control allow lists.


Executable

Function

Applicable To

FlowaceService.exe

Core Windows service. Manages all child processes, authentication, and data sync.

Interactive

FlowaceSSGen.exe

Screenshot generation module.

Interactive

FlowaceRTCHandler.exe

Real-time communication handler for live status and configuration updates.

Interactive

FlowaceApplicationTimer.exe

Application and URL timer. Tracks active window and time spent per application.

Interactive

FlowaceNetworkBandiwidth.exe

Network bandwidth monitor. Measures connectivity and data consumption.

Interactive

NativeMessagingHost.exe

Browser extension bridge for Google Chrome and Microsoft Edge.

Interactive/Silent

FirefoxNativeMessagingHost.exe

Browser extension bridge for Mozilla Firefox.

Interactive/Silent

MoveInstallationDir.exe

Installation utility. Relocates agent files during install, upgrade, and migration.

Interactive

FlowaceActivityTracker.exe

Tracks keyboard & Mouse Activity.

Interactive

WinFApplicationTimer.exe

Application and URL timer. Tracks active window and time spent per application.

Silent

WinFRTCHandler.exe

Real-time communication handler for live status and configuration updates.

Silent

WinFService.exe

Core Windows service. Manages all child processes, authentication, and data sync.

Silent

WinFSSGen.exe

Screenshot generation module.

Silent

WinFActivityTracker.exe

Tracks keyboard & Mouse Activity.

Silent



Best Practices

●Whitelist Flowace services on internal infrastructure (network, proxy, endpoint protection) to guarantee uninterrupted functioning of the Flowace app.
●Monitor antivirus, firewall, VPN, and other security settings on an ongoing basis. Updates to these tools can silently re-block previously whitelisted services.
●If tracking issues persist after whitelisting, check for VPN split-tunneling rules or proxy configurations that may re-route or inspect traffic to the hosts listed in Section 1.
